wow that's really cool, as I'm going to finish sixth form this year, should I apply for a degree apprenticeship or should I do an advanced apprenticeship, then upgrade to a degree apprenticeship.
Original post by h.zkr
wow that's really cool, as I'm going to finish sixth form this year, should I apply for a degree apprenticeship or should I do an advanced apprenticeship, then upgrade to a degree apprenticeship.

Go for degree apprenticeships, the only reason I did advanced first was because I did it instead of alevels, the jobs that advanced apprenticeships provide are quite different to degree ones - they tend to be more menial jobs.
